Subject: Re: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H 2/6] pc: add I440FX QOM cast macro
Date: Sun, 28 Jul 2013 19:21:45 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20130728192145.67ede786@thinkpad>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<51F4EAFA.3070106@suse.de>

On Sun, 28 Jul 2013 11:57:14 +0200
Andreas Färber <afaerber@suse.de> wrote:

> Am 28.07.2013 09:29, schrieb Igor Mammedov:
> > Signed-off-by: Igor Mammedov <imammedo@redhat.com>
> > ---
> >  hw/pci-host/piix.c | 8 ++++++--
> >  1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
> > 
> > diff --git a/hw/pci-host/piix.c b/hw/pci-host/piix.c
> > index 3908860..bf879e7 100644
> > --- a/hw/pci-host/piix.c
> > +++ b/hw/pci-host/piix.c
> > @@ -38,6 +38,10 @@
> >   * http://download.intel.com/design/chipsets/datashts/29054901.pdf
> >   */
> >  
> > +#define TYPE_I440FX_PCI_HOST "i440FX-pcihost"
> > +#define I440FX_PCI_HOST(obj) \
> > +    OBJECT_CHECK(I440FXState, (obj), TYPE_I440FX_PCI_HOST)
> 
> Either Anthony or mst had insisted on PCI_HOST_BRIDGE rather than
> PCI_HOST. Other than that looks good, thanks!

it's the type cast macro that is missing, so adding it shouldn't hurt,
and some day in future we might any way need to add it even if we don't use it
now.
